MEMO — To the Board of Tessamark Holdings. Re: next year's headcount plan. After careful review of demand forecasts and the Wrenfold expansion, management proposes a net increase of eighteen positions, concentrated in engineering and client services. Savings from the Delmore consolidation offset roughly half the cost. Attrition assumptions remain conservative at six percent. We request approval at the November session. The detailed plan appears in the confidential note below.

internal memo for kawip-hadug: Headcount on the Wenwyn team goes from 7 to 140 by the end of January. Gross margin on Wenwyn came in at 20 percent against a plan of 15 percent.

# Break-glass: Crashfunnel pipeline

Quick note for the sync: if the Crashfunnel pipeline (our mobile crash-report ingester) wedges and symbols stop uploading from the Norbury build farm, don't wait for on-call — use break-glass. Hit the admin console, flip ingestion to bypass mode, and requeue the stuck batches. Yes, it's fine, it's designed for this. The console will ask for the recovery passphrase, which is given below.

unlock words, tajep-fafof: fraiel-wenvan-gorox-jorox-wenok-sorion-fenion

## Authentication

Heads up: the nightly reindex job (`reindex_nightly.py`) talks to the Lanternfish search cluster, and that cluster won't accept anonymous writes anymore — we locked it down last sprint. The job now authenticates as the `reindex-runner` service identity against Corvid Gateway, and the token is injected via the `LF_INDEX_TOKEN` env var in the scheduler config. Nothing clever going on, just a bearer header on every batch request. For review purposes, the staging credential currently in use is listed below.

service key, kadug-kadup: kto15_rN23XLAYImmZgrJ

During Tuesday's audit we found that three of the seven backend nodes serving the Pellbrook API report different health-check paths and timeout values than what our provisioning templates specify. The drift appears to have been introduced by a manual hotfix in March that was never backported. The load balancer still routes traffic, but failover behavior is inconsistent across nodes. For the weekly sync, I've reconciled everything against the template; the intended settings follow below.

deployment values, faduf-tawep:
SORDOR_LOG_LEVEL=error
SORDOR_METRICS_HOST=metrics.sordor.nelvrolabs.internal
SORDOR_POOL_SIZE=4